Types of metal sintered mesh: standard sintered mesh, multi-layer sintered mesh, fluidized plate sintered mesh, square hole sintered mesh, punched plate sintered mesh, densely woven sintered mesh;
Metal sintered mesh material: SS304, SS316, SS316L, SS904L, 2205, 2507, SS310S, Hastelloy, Monel, Inconel and other nickel-based alloy wire mesh as raw materials.
Metal sintered mesh production implementation standards: Stainless steel metal sintered mesh materials and their component manufacturing and testing standards are implemented in accordance with GB/T25863-2010;
Metal sintered mesh specifications: standard sizes are 500×1000mm, 600×1200mm, 1000×1000mm, 1200×1200mm. Dimensions within the above range can be customized according to user requirements.
Metal sintered mesh filtration accuracy: 1-300μm;
Characteristics of metal sintered mesh:
1. High strength and good rigidity: it has the highest mechanical strength and compressive strength. It has good processing, welding and assembly performance and is easy to use.
2. Stable filtration accuracy: Because the five-layer sintered mesh filter layer is protected by protective mesh above and below, coupled with the diffusion solid solution sintering process, the filter mesh holes are not easily deformed. The filter layer is on the second layer, with one side diverting and one side protected. The filtration efficiency is uniform and has high stability.
3. Strong corrosion resistance and heat resistance: The standard five-layer sintered mesh is mostly made of stainless steel SUS316L and 304, so it has good corrosion resistance. The heat resistance of stainless steel determines that the standard mesh made of fired stainless steel wire mesh can be used for filtration in temperatures ranging from -200°C to 480°C and in acid and alkali environments.
4. Easy to clean: Its surface filter structure has the best countercurrent cleaning effect, can be used repeatedly, and has a long life.
5. Easy to process: Suitable for various processing techniques such as cutting, bending, stamping, machining and welding.
Application fields of metal sintered mesh: Product applications have been widely distributed in purification and filtration, separation and recovery of solid particles, divergent cooling of extreme high-temperature environments, air flow distribution control, air flotation transmission, gas sample collection, enhanced mass transfer and heat transfer, and flame retardant Explosion-proof, etc. The characteristics of sintered mesh determine its practical application in many industrial fields such as petrochemical industry, metallurgical machinery, energy and environmental protection, textile power, aerospace, medicine, etc.
